He was wrong. That is not how homoeopathy works. Homoeopathy does not work on the basis of 'more is better', and in fact actually works on the basis that 'less is better'. Law of the minimum dose is one of our primary principles - you give only enough to create change in the patient, and you MUST assess the patient regularly to see if such change is happening.

It certainly does not mean if you give the wrong remedy long enough, something will happen. A practioner needs to be humble or honest enough to admit that their prescription is wrong, so that patients do not get harmed.

You are now appearing to mix several medicines together. This also breaks one of the cardinal rules of homoeopathy, law of the single remedy. There may be interactions and problems arising from doing so.
